INTRODUCTION

Initiated in 2014, the National Centre of Competence in Research (NCCR) Digital
Fabrication aims to revolutionise architecture through the seamless combination
of digital technologies and physical building processes. Over 60 researchers
from six different academic disciplines collaborate to develop ground-breaking
technologies for tomorrow’s construction. Their research allows Switzerland to
take a leading position within the global field of digital fabrication. The NCCR
Digital Fabrication is the first NCCR focused on architecture and construction
funded by the Swiss National Science Foundation (SNSF). Initiated at ETH Zurich,
it is partnered with EPF Lausanne, the Hochschule für Technik Rapperswil, the
Lucerne University of Applied Sciences and Arts, the Bern University of Applied
Sciences and Empa.
